Jacquelynn Dobrin

Jacquelynn first started as a part time news anchor and reporter for WSVA in 2022. Before the launch of Rocktown Now in April of 2024, she was Assistant Editor and then became Editor-in-Chief in November of 2024.

New Brocks Gap Natural Area Preserve protects rare forest

A mature stand of northern white cedar trees along the North Fork of the Shenandoah River, Virginia’s largest remaining example of this globally rare forest, is now protected as part of Brocks Gap Natural Area Preserve.

Court Square Theater closing doors on New Year’s Eve

The Arts Council of the Valley Board of Directors voted December 17 to cease operations of Court Square Theater, with the closure set to take effect December 31, 2025, citing long-term funding losses and declining audience attendance.

Staunton unveils Juvenile & Domestic Relations District Court

The new Court facility includes two courtrooms, secure areas for the Sheriff’s Office, Clerk’s Office, and Court Service Unit, as well as satellite office spaces for the Commonwealth’s Attorney, Public Attorney, Public Defender, and mediator/victim advocate services.
